Rackspace Hosts DGLP Sites

August 3, 2007 — (WEB HOST INDUSTRY REVIEW) –  Digital media sharing and social networking platform DigitalPost Interactive (dglp.com) announced this week it has selected Web hosting provider Rackspace Managed Hosting (rackspace.com) as the hosting provider for its two Web properties, TheFamilyPost.com and WebsitesForHeroes.com.

Rackspace provides an extra layer of security and reliability by providing a 100 percent network uptime guarantee and tools to enable DigitalPost Interactive to recover customer photos, videos and other sensitive data within minutes in the case of a local disaster, says the company.

“We are very committed to protecting the photos, videos, and other priceless memories that our customers post on our sites each and every day,” says Robert Grant, director of technology at DigitalPost Interactive. “In today’s digital age, people need a place online where they can store and share their digital media with confidence. By partnering with Rackspace, we’re raising the bar in terms of reliability, and delivering on our promise of making digital media sharing and social networking a safe and enjoyable experience for everyone.”

Rackspace offers global managed hosting solutions, and has partnered with companies like Cisco Systems and Iron Mountain. Rackspace says its Fanatical Support has helped the company become a recognized leader in the global managed hosting market and a trusted business partner for companies concerned about safe-housing critical data.

The company announced last week it teamed up with ComponentOne in order to increase exposure for both companies while adding new value for ComponentOne’s current clients.
